About Ryo Natsuaki

Ryo Natsuaki is a scholar working on Aerospace Engineering, Environmental Engineering and Computational Mathematics, having authored 109 papers that have together received 772 indexed citations. Recurring topics across this work include Synthetic Aperture Radar (SAR) Applications and Techniques (72 papers), Advanced SAR Imaging Techniques (43 papers) and Soil Moisture and Remote Sensing (32 papers). The work is most often cited by research in Aerospace Engineering (382 citations), Geophysics (187 citations) and Environmental Engineering (139 citations). Ryo Natsuaki has collaborated with scholars based in Japan, Germany and United States. Frequent co-authors include Akira Hirose, Masanobu Shimada, Diego Melgar, Eric O. Lindsey, Manabu Hashimoto, Xiaohua Xu, David T. Sandwell, Takeshi Motohka, Hiroto Nagai and Shin-ichi Suzuki. Their work appears in journals such as SHILAP Revista de lepidopterología, Remote Sensing of Environment and Geophysical Research Letters.
